#A7C247 Hex Color Code

#A7C247

The Hexadecimal Color #A7C247 is a contrast shade of Yellow Green. #A7C247 RGB value is rgb(167, 194, 71). RGB Color Model of #A7C247 consists of 65% red, 76% green and 27% blue. HSL color Mode of #A7C247 has 73°(degrees) Hue, 50%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#A7C247 color has an wavelength of 574.03704n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A7C247 is #CCCC66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A7C247 is #AB4. The Closest Color to #A7C247 is #9ACD32. Official Name of #A7C247 Hex Code is Celery.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A7C247 is 14 Cyan 0 Magenta 63 Yellow 24 Black and #A7C247 CMY is 14, 0, 63.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#A7C247 is hsl(73,50,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(73, 63, 76).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#A7C247 is 36.37, 47.25, 13.17.
Hex8 Value of #A7C247 is #A7C247FF. Decimal Value of #A7C247 is 10994247 and Octal Value of #A7C247 is 51741107. Binary Value of #A7C247 is 10100111, 11000010, 1000111 and Android of #A7C247 is 4289184327 / 0xffa7c247.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#A7C247 is 0.376, 0.488, 0.488 and YIQ Color Space of #A7C247 is 171.905, 23.4306, -43.9881.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#A7C247 is 44.81, 54.7, 13.7.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#A7C247 is 74.35, -26.44, 56.87.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#A7C247 is 74.35, -12.01, 71.16.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#A7C247 is 74.35, 62.72, 114.93. Hunter Lab variable of #A7C247 is 68.74, -25.85, 36.76.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A7C247

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
